Boost Pump: (Not used very often) This selects the product during which you would like the optional
Boost Pump to be active. Extra harnessing is needed for this option. Typically will be DISABLED,
unless using the Boost Pump option.
Pump Start Mode: Typically, only important on electric pump control. When set as Momentary Start,
the output is only on for 3 seconds when the batch start is pressed. When set to Maintained Start, the
pump start output is on as long as the batch is active. Maintained is the correct choice for hydraulic
pumps and probably the best choice for electric, but it depends on the users motor control center. If
the motor has a start-stop push-button setup, Momentary may need to be the setting.
Carrier Throttling Valve % Open: Default is 75. Used only on Suction systems. This will close the
carrier valve to the designated percentage to create more suction when product is being pulled into the
batch.
Product Valves: Select DISABLED to disable that valve and to prevent it from opening even if a
recipe calls for that valve. This may be needed to allow a batch to run even if one of the valves is not
operating.
Valve Close Time: Use this to fine-tune the product valves shutoff to hit the Target. This is the
amount of time before the Target amount is reached that the valve will start to close. If the batch is
overshooting the Target, increase this time so the valve will begin shutting sooner. If the batch is
undershooting the Target, decrease this time so the valve will stay open longer before shutting. The
default value for a 1valve is 1.5 seconds. The default for a 2” valve is 3.2 seconds.
Manual Product Valve Select: Default and typical setting is 2 Inch Venturi for a Venturi (Non-
Suction) system. To set the QuickDraw in bypass mode, select 3 Inch Valve.
